    Bilet Grill?

    I have a silver camaro...and i want a black billet grill. Can someone tell me where to find a black one for the cheapest price, and the best material...also, im confused on the installation of it. Do you remove your old grill, so that the paint shows under the new bilet grill, or do you just put the bilet grill over your existing one. Also, how hard are they to install?

    Install is painless. You just remove the stock black flashing, pops out, then the billet part goes in with 4 screws.

    Stainless holds a shine a little better than aluminum but if you are going to paint it anyway I'd just go with the aluminum since it's not as expensive. I got mine off of Ebay pretty cheap. Install is super easy, just zip in 4 screws and you are done.

    I just want to chime back in about Stainless, defiantly better than the aluminum. All the sides of the bars on the aluminum models are exposed aluminum. On my stainless, just the front of the bars is exposed stainless, the other sides are black. It looks much better that way IMO
